Notion AI vs ClickUp AI for Small Business

Notion AI and ClickUp AI both help small businesses manage projects and documentation, but they serve different primary needs. Notion AI excels at writing, summarization, and knowledge management, while ClickUp AI is stronger at task automation, project tracking, and workflow optimization. Your choice depends on whether your team needs a better thinking tool or a better doing tool.

Key Takeaways

  • Notion AI ($10/user/month add-on) focuses on writing assistance, Q&A across your workspace, and document summarization
  • ClickUp AI ($7/user/month add-on) focuses on task creation, status updates, and workflow automation
  • Small teams that rely heavily on documentation and wikis will get more from Notion AI
  • Teams managing complex projects with dependencies and sprints should lean toward ClickUp AI
  • Both tools can reduce weekly admin time by 3-5 hours per team member based on reported user data

What Does Notion AI Actually Do?

Notion AI is built into Notion’s workspace and acts as a writing and research assistant across all your pages, databases, and wikis. It can draft content, summarize meeting notes, translate text, and answer questions by pulling from everything in your workspace.

The standout feature is Q&A. You can ask Notion AI questions like “What was decided in last week’s marketing meeting?” and it pulls the answer from your actual notes. For small businesses that keep their SOPs, meeting notes, and project docs in Notion, this is a genuine time saver.

Notion AI also generates action items from meeting notes, rewrites drafts in different tones, and creates templates from scratch. It costs $10 per member per month on top of your Notion plan.

What Does ClickUp AI Actually Do?

ClickUp AI (called ClickUp Brain) is wired directly into ClickUp’s project management system. Instead of helping you write better, it helps you manage work faster. It can create tasks from descriptions, generate subtasks, write status update summaries, and auto-fill project fields.

The most useful feature for small businesses is the automatic standup. ClickUp AI scans what your team worked on yesterday, what’s due today, and what’s blocked, then writes a summary. No more 15-minute standup meetings to say “I’m still working on the same thing.”

ClickUp Brain costs $7 per member per month as an add-on. It works across tasks, docs, dashboards, and whiteboards within the ClickUp ecosystem.

How Do They Compare on Writing?

Notion AI is the stronger writer. It handles blog drafts, email templates, SOPs, and creative brainstorming well. It can adjust tone, expand or compress text, and work with long-form content.

ClickUp AI writes, but it’s focused on project-related content: task descriptions, comments, status updates, and reports. If you need to draft a client proposal or a team handbook, Notion AI handles that better.

For a small business producing content or maintaining a knowledge base, Notion AI saves roughly 2 hours per week on writing tasks alone.

How Do They Compare on Task Management?

ClickUp AI wins on task management by a wide margin. It can break a goal into tasks, assign priorities, estimate time, and even suggest dependencies. Notion has databases that function as task boards, but the AI doesn’t deeply understand project workflows the way ClickUp’s does.

If your team juggles multiple client projects or runs sprints, ClickUp AI’s ability to generate project plans from a single description saves significant setup time. One user reported cutting project setup from 45 minutes to 10 minutes per new client.

Pricing Breakdown for Small Teams

For a team of 5:

  • Notion (Plus + AI): $10/user (plan) + $10/user (AI) = $100/month
  • ClickUp (Business + AI): $12/user (plan) + $7/user (AI) = $95/month

The pricing is close enough that cost shouldn’t be the deciding factor. Both offer free tiers to test the base product, but AI features are paid add-ons on both platforms.

Which One Should You Pick?

Choose Notion AI if your business runs on documents, wikis, and written communication. It’s the better tool for content teams, consulting firms, and businesses with heavy documentation needs.

Choose ClickUp AI if your business runs on tasks, deadlines, and workflows. It’s the better tool for agencies, development teams, and service businesses managing multiple projects.

Can You Use Both Together?

Yes. Notion and ClickUp integrate through Zapier and Make. A common setup: keep your SOPs and client documentation in Notion, manage project execution in ClickUp, and use both AI assistants within their respective domains.

The integration isn’t native, so there’s some manual setup involved. But for a team of 5-10, the combined cost of both platforms with AI ($195/month for 5 users) can still be cheaper than hiring a part-time admin.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is Notion AI worth it for a solo business owner?

Yes, if you write frequently. Notion AI at $10/month pays for itself if it saves you even 30 minutes of writing per week. Solo owners who don’t create much written content may not see enough value.

Can ClickUp AI replace a project manager?

Not entirely, but it handles the repetitive parts. Automatic standups, task generation, and status summaries remove busywork. A small team of 3-5 can operate without a dedicated PM by using ClickUp AI for the administrative overhead.

Do these AI features work on mobile?

Both Notion AI and ClickUp AI work in their mobile apps, though the experience is more limited than desktop. Complex features like document Q&A in Notion work best on desktop.

Which has better integrations?

ClickUp has more native integrations (over 1,000) compared to Notion (roughly 100 native, more via Zapier). For small businesses using many tools, ClickUp connects more easily out of the box.
